Cozy Lakefront Condo at Chinquapin | Unit 160
Summary: Enjoy wonderful, panoramic views of Lake Tahoe from this comfortable lakefront condo.
The Space: Other features include granite countertops, vaulted ceilings, skylights, an HD flat screen TV, a gas fireplace, and a 168-square foot deck with patio table, 4 dining chairs, a dual rocking chair, a lounge chair and a propane barbecue.
The Neighborhood: Chinquapin is a private, gated community consisting of 95-wooded acres along a mile of Lake Tahoe’s pristine shoreline. Secluded coves, sandy beaches, towering evergreens, and natural wildflowers reflect in the crystal clarity of Lake Tahoe, creating one of nature’s most awe-inspiring sights. Chinquapin's amenities include saunas, tennis and pickleball courts, bocce ball courts, a mile-long lakefront path, two piers, and more.
Getting Around: Chinquapin is about a five minute drive to Tahoe City (three miles), and 10-15 minutes away from Squaw Valley, Alpine Meadows, and Northstar ski areas.
